Global market valuation was derived through revenue mapping and catalyst consumption volume analysis. The methodology included:
Identification of 50+ key catalyst manufacturers and technology licensors across North America, Europe, Asia-Pacific, Middle East, and Latin America
Product mapping across Ziegler-Natta catalysts, metallocene catalysts, chromium-based catalysts, and emerging single-site catalyst categories
Technology segmentation analysis covering supported catalysts (silica-based, magnesium chloride-based) and unsupported catalyst systems
Application-specific analysis across ethylene polymerization (HDPE, LDPE, LLDPE), propylene polymerization (homopolymer, random copolymer, impact copolymer), and butene-1 polymerization
Analysis of reported and modeled annual revenues specific to polyolefin catalyst portfolios
Coverage of manufacturers representing 75-80% of global market share in 2024
Extrapolation using bottom-up (catalyst consumption volume × ASP by catalyst type and region) and top-down (manufacturer revenue validation) approaches to derive segment-specific valuations across automotive, packaging, construction, and consumer goods end-use industries
This methodology is tailored specifically for the polyolefin catalyst market segments identified in the report: Ziegler-Natta vs. Metallocene catalysts, Supported vs. Unsupported technologies, Ethylene/Propylene/Butene-1 polymerization applications, and end-use industries including automotive, packaging, construction, and consumer goods.
